It had become the symbol of the floods in Haute-: the Panga cow was found dead after being swept away by the floods.

The video showing her being swept away by the waves had gone viral: Panga, who had become a symbol of the devastating floods in the Center-East, was found dead, her breeders indicated on social networks.

“We found Panga”write on their Facebook account the breeders of the Groupement agricole d’exploitation en commun (Gaec) du nid, in Chambon-sur-Lignon (Haute-). “She traveled several kilometers before ending up in a meadow just before Tence,” they added in a message broadcast on Saturday and accompanied by a photo of the animal’s carcass, covered out of modesty with a crying face emoji.

Panga was part of a herd of five cows which had been caught by the waters of the Lignon, which entered a historic flood at the height of the floods on Thursday.

“They were surrounded by the Lignon. There was at least 1.50 meters of water on the plot with a strong current,” said Étienne Valla, the owner of the livestock, in a video from the local daily Le Progrès.

“Four fled to the banks and the fifth (Panga) went wandering,” he added.

Images of the waves as big as a wisp of straw for a cow struggling to keep its head above water have made the rounds on social networks.

“Thank you to the firefighters for their help and to all those affected by this story,” conclude the breeders in their Facebook message.
